Monthly Invitation to Rest Ep 4: Let Go
from The Unclouded Hours Podcast · host Diana M Smith
‘The trees are about to show us how beautiful it can be to let go,’ reads the chalkboard sign outside of a cafe. This golden month of October as the trees shed all they’ve produced, we step outside to take in the view of a wider horizon—a practice scientists have discovered changes our physiology and mental capacity. With the aid of a short poem by Archibald Lampman titled Refuge, look at, What is the act of rest? How do we do it?, and a tangible way to take the weight that we carry and lay it down—just, lay it down. What stands out to you from the poem? How will you rest this month?
